This is a critical leadership role within the Flutter UK & Ireland AI Platform initiative. The AI Engineering Team Manager will be responsible for building and leading a high‑performing engineering squad across multiple locations, focused on delivering core components of a multi‑tenant, enterprise‑grade AI platform. This platform will underpin the next generation of AI capabilities across the business — from internal assistants (e.g. Flint) through to advanced agentic systems and domain‑specific AI services. You will combine hands‑on technical leadership with people leadership, ensuring high‑quality engineering delivery while shaping best practices for building scalable, secure, and production‑ready AI systems on AWS.
Key Responsibilities
- Engineering Leadership
- Build, lead, and develop a cross‑functional engineering team (backend / full stack)
- Set engineering standards, patterns, and ways of working aligned to platform‑first principles
- Drive a culture of ownership, quality, and continuous improvement
- Platform Delivery
- Lead the design and delivery of core AI platform services (APIs, orchestration layers, integration services)
- Contribute to the development of a multi‑tenant AI control plane with built‑in governance, security, and observability
- Ensure solutions are scalable, reusable, and aligned to enterprise architecture standards
- Technical Direction
- Provide hands‑on guidance across system design, architecture, and implementation
- Partner with Architecture, Security, and Platform teams to ensure alignment with AWS best practices (incl. Bedrock and cloud‑native services)
- Support design reviews and contribute to Technical Design Authority (TDA) processes
- AI & Emerging Technology
- Enable the team to build AI‑powered services, including LLM integrations, agent frameworks, and retrieval‑based systems
- Ensure responsible AI practices are embedded (guardrails, auditability, data controls)
- Delivery & Collaboration
- Work closely with Product, Business Analysis, and Engagement teams to translate use cases into deliverable outcomes
- Support iterative MVP delivery, balancing speed with long‑term platform integrity
- Collaborate across UK&I and International teams to drive consistency and reuse
Essential Skills & Experience
- Strong experience as a senior or lead engineer in backend or full stack development
- Proven experience leading engineering teams and delivering complex distributed systems
- Experience building cloud‑native applications on AWS (e.g. Lambda, API Gateway, ECS, DynamoDB, etc.)
- Strong understanding of system design, APIs, and microservices architecture
- Experience working in agile environments with modern engineering practices
Desirable
- Experience working with AI/ML systems or integrating with LLMs (e.g. Amazon Bedrock or similar)
- Knowledge of multi‑tenant architectures and platform engineering concepts
- Experience with observability, security, and governance in enterprise systems
- Familiarity with event‑driven architectures and data pipelines
